See Plate 22 for Baillon's Crake and other similar species
Resident Status: | Casual |
---|---|
Length: | 17-19 cm, Wing Span:33-37 cm |
Distribution Map: | Map 101. |
Adult: | Red-brown upperparts densely spotted with white; gray-blue below with black-and-white barred flanks and undertail coverts. Green bill, red iris; legs vary from olive-green to dull pink. |
Juvenile: | Pale brown face, mottled gray-brown underparts, brownish iris, and usually pinkish legs. |
Similar Species: | Little Crake, Spotted Crake. |
Behavior: | Skulking, rarely seen away from reedbeds. |
Habitat: | Densely vegetated ponds and rivers. |
Food: | Aquatic insects, plants. |
